Food Scientist and Technologist cover letter tips
Do
- +Do quantify achievements, e.g., 'Implemented a new sanitation protocol that reduced audit non-conformances by 30%.'
- +Do explicitly connect your technical skills (like R for data analysis) and soft skills (like Critical Thinking) to the listed job tasks.
- +Do mention specific regulations (e.g., FDA, USDA, HACCP) and types of products (e.g., baked goods, beverages, dairy) relevant to the company's sector.
Don't
- -Don't use generic statements; be specific about food science projects, methodologies, and technologies you've used.
- -Don't just list your skills; explain *how* you used them to perform tasks like inspection, development, or standardization.
- -Don't forget to express genuine interest in the company's specific products or research focus to show you've done your homework.
